Understanding the Basics of Soccer⁣ Betting Odds

When ‍navigating the world of⁣ soccer betting, understanding how‌ odds ⁢work is crucial. Odds represent the‍ probability of a⁣ particular outcome occurring in⁢ a match ⁣and ⁤are typically‌ displayed in‍ three main‍ formats: decimal, fractional,⁤ and‍ moneyline. ‍Each​ format ⁢offers‍ a different⁤ way‌ to convey the ​same information,​ so it’s important to grasp their‍ nuances. For⁣ instance, decimal odds are ⁤the‌ most straightforward, ‍showing ⁤the ‌total return‌ on a stake, while fractional odds are ​traditional ‍and ​more common in⁤ the UK, presenting ⁢a​ ratio ⁤between the stake and potential winnings.⁣ Moneyline ⁤odds, often used in the US, indicate how much​ a bettor can ⁤win or⁣ needs to ‌wager, depending on ⁤whether ‌the odds are positive or negative.

To illustrate how odds translate⁢ into‍ potential payouts, consider the ‌following table:

Odds Format Example⁤ Odds Payout on⁤ $100 Bet
Decimal 1.50 $150 (including stake)
Fractional 1/2 $150 (including‍ stake)
Moneyline -200 $50‍ (profit)

Understanding these⁢ formats can help you make strategic‍ decisions when ‍placing your bets. As you familiarize yourself with soccer⁣ betting odds, you’ll also find ​that‌ bookmakers may offer odds that⁢ fluctuate based on factors like team form and player injuries. Strategies for Analyzing‍ Odds to Identify Value Bets

To identify value ⁢bets in soccer betting, a thorough understanding⁤ of the odds ‍is crucial. Start by comparing ⁣the odds offered by various bookmakers against your own​ assessment of the team’s performance and ‍probabilities. Key elements ‌to⁣ consider include:

  • Team form ⁣and statistics
  • Head-to-head records
  • Injuries and suspensions affecting key players
  • Home and away ‌performance

Once ​you⁢ have gathered this information, your goal ‍is to pinpoint ⁣discrepancies between your‍ calculated probabilities and the bookmakers’ odds. If, ⁤for⁣ example, you believe a team winning has a‌ probability of 60% but the⁢ odds suggest only ⁣a 40% chance, this indicates⁢ a potential value bet. To visually track these assessments, consider creating an analytical table:

Team Calculated‌ Probability (%) Bookmaker Odds (%) Value Bet?
Team A 60 40 ✔️
Team B 45 55 ✖️

Q&A:⁤ Understanding Soccer Betting Odds

Q: What are soccer betting odds?

A: ​Soccer ⁢betting ⁣odds ⁤are numerical representations ⁢that⁢ indicate⁣ the likelihood of a particular ⁣outcome in a ⁤match, such as a team winning, losing, or drawing. They serve as a guide ‍for bettors ‍to determine ⁤potential payouts based on⁣ their ​wagers.

Q: How‌ are soccer betting odds​ displayed?
A: Odds‍ can be formatted in several ways: Decimal, Fractional, ⁤or American. Decimal ⁣odds (e.g., 2.50) show the total​ payout, including the⁣ stake.​ Fractional ⁤odds (e.g., 5/2) represent profit⁤ against the stake, ⁢and American‍ odds (e.g.,⁢ +250 or‍ -200) ‍indicate how much you can win on a $100 bet or ​how much you need ⁤to wager ‍to ​win ‍$100, ⁢respectively.

Q: What do different⁣ odds imply about⁤ a team’s chances?

A: Generally, ⁣lower odds indicate ‌a higher probability of the outcome occurring, while higher odds suggest a lower probability. For ⁤example, if Team A⁣ has odds of 1.50‌ to win, they’re favored ⁣to win compared to Team B’s odds of 3.50.

Q: What is the ‍significance of ‌implied probability?
A: Implied probability converts odds into a percentage⁢ that reflects ‍the ⁢bookmaker’s‍ estimation of ⁢an​ outcome’s likelihood. For instance, with decimal odds of 2.00, the‍ implied ⁣probability ‍is 50%, suggesting ‌the bookmaker believes there is a 50% chance the event⁢ will occur.

Q: ⁤How⁣ do I calculate my potential winnings from betting odds?

A: ‍To ​calculate ⁣your ⁢potential ⁣winnings, simply multiply your ⁢stake by​ the odds. For example, if you bet ​$10 ⁤at 3.00​ odds, your potential return would ⁤be $10 x 3.00 = $30, which includes⁢ your​ initial stake and ⁣winnings.

Q:⁣ What is the role of bookmakers in setting these odds?

A: ⁢Bookmakers analyze various factors—such ‌as team form, injuries, weather conditions, and historical performance—to ‍set odds‍ that reflect⁣ the probability of each outcome. Their goal is to​ balance​ the‌ betting action ‌on both sides ​to⁤ minimize ⁢risk and ⁣ensure ​profitability.

Q:‌ Can betting odds​ change? ⁤Why does ⁢that ⁤happen?

A: Yes, odds can fluctuate ‌due to ⁣a ‍variety of factors ⁣like changes​ in team line-ups, injury⁤ news, ​or‍ heavy betting on one side. If more ⁤bettors wager on a⁤ certain outcome,‌ bookmakers ‍may adjust the ⁤odds ⁣to balance the‌ action and mitigate⁤ potential‌ losses.

Q: ‍Are there different types of soccer bets, and⁣ do they⁤ have different odds?
A:‌ Absolutely! There ‌are various betting options, ⁣including ​match winner (1X2), over/under goals,⁤ correct score,‍ and more. Each type of bet ⁢has its own ⁢set of odds based on the complexity ⁤and⁤ perceived ⁤risk ‌of the outcome.

Q: Can beginners successfully read‌ and ‌use ​soccer ‍betting odds?

A: Yes! ‍While it may take ​some practice to understand the different formats and dynamics of odds, ⁢with careful⁢ observation and⁤ study, ‍even beginners can start to⁢ make well-informed betting decisions. Remember, the​ key‌ is to‌ stay informed and bet ⁣responsibly. ‌
